Expert Review
At Tractor Supply, the cashier/customer service associate role offers an engaging way to connect with customers while managing transactions. Paying $14-$18 per hour, it provides a decent wage for entry-level retail positions in Fresno. The job involves assisting customers with inquiries and purchases, making strong communication skills essential.
Expect to juggle multiple responsibilities, from operating the register to restocking shelves. This variety can be appealing, but the role also demands physical stamina. The fast-paced environment may not suit everyone, especially those preferring a more sedentary job.
Customer service is at the heart of this position, requiring patience and a positive attitude. While it’s a great opportunity to gain retail experience, the challenges of dealing with difficult customers can be a downside. Overall, the role is rewarding for those who thrive in active work environments and enjoy direct customer interaction.
